Plan Your Narrative Flow

A well-structured narrative is the backbone of any compelling presentation. Begin by outlining your key points and determining where 3D graphics can best enhance the story. Visualize how these elements will transition between slides and how they contribute to the overall message. This planning stage ensures that every 3D graphic serves a purpose, whether it’s illustrating complex data, depicting a scene, or adding an interactive element to engage the audience more deeply.

Customize and Optimize

Customization is key to maintaining brand consistency and audience engagement. Adjust the 3D graphics to align with your presentation’s theme by altering colors, scales, or lighting to match your brand’s aesthetics. Consider the audience’s perspective and optimize the visual elements for clarity and impact. Incorporating smooth transitions and varied camera angles can add a cinematic quality to your presentation, making it more memorable.

Test and Iterate

Before delivering your presentation, conduct thorough testing to ensure all 3D elements function correctly. Check for smooth transitions, proper alignment, and interactive elements. Gather feedback from a test audience to identify areas for improvement. Iteration is critical; refine your presentation based on feedback to enhance clarity and engagement.

Strategic Use of Color and Contrast

Color and contrast play a pivotal role in guiding audience attention and evoking emotions. By choosing the right color palette, storytellers can set the mood and tone of their narrative. For instance, warm colors like reds and oranges can evoke passion and urgency, while cooler tones like blues and greens promote calmness and trust. Contrast, on the other hand, is essential for highlighting key elements within a story, ensuring that important information stands out.

Creating a Narrative Arc

Every compelling story follows a narrative arc, a structure that guides the audience through a beginning, middle, and end. In visual storytelling, this arc can be enhanced by using visuals that mirror the story’s progression. Start by introducing characters or settings with clear and vivid images, then build tension or conflict with dynamic visuals, and finally, resolve with a satisfying conclusion that ties all elements together. This approach keeps the audience engaged and invested in the outcome.

Utilizing Movement and Animation

Incorporating movement and animation into your storytelling can significantly enhance engagement. Movement draws the eye and can be used to emphasize transitions between scenes or highlight critical points. For example, animations can simulate processes or demonstrate changes over time, providing clarity to complex subjects. By strategically using animations, storytellers can maintain audience interest and ensure that the narrative remains dynamic and captivating.

Integrating Sound and Music

Sound and music are powerful tools for enhancing the emotional depth of a narrative. A well-chosen soundtrack can amplify the emotional impact of a visual story, aligning with the mood and tone of the visuals. Sound effects, such as ambient noise or character voices, can make the story more immersive, drawing the audience deeper into the narrative world. Thoughtful integration of audio elements ensures a multi-sensory experience that enriches the storytelling process.
